Leeds United: Bid for Warren Feeney on hold

SPL outfit Hearts have entered to race to sign Warren Feeney after his propsed move to Leeds United was put on hold.
The Northern Ireland international striker was linked with United - where he started his career as a trainee - at the beginning of the week.

But the Jambos have now thrown their hat into the ring to sign the Cardiff City frontman, 28, who spent last season on loan at Dundee United.

Charlton, Norwich, Huddersfield and Grimsby have also been linked with a move for the Ulsterman, who never made a first-team appearance during his stint at United from 1998-2001.
